TEHRAN (ISNA)- Iran plans to launch three new shipping lines in Caspian Sea to facilitate goods exports to Russia and Caspian Sea neighboring states.

The shipping lines would be launched in northern Iranian ports of Anzali, Noshahr and Amir-Abad.

Iranian economic officials have decided to expand foreign trading which would come true in global and regional markets, especially with Russia following improvement of international atmosphere for foreign trading.

Iran-Russia trading totals $2 billion and the country’s total export with other Caspian Sea states reach $10-15 billion.

Launching the shipping lines, six trips would be made to Aktau ports in Kazakhstan and Astrakhan in Russia each month.

The ships are capable of carrying 2200-6500 tons of goods and are equipped with refrigerator containers which facilitates carrying sensitive goods such as plants and fruit.

90 percent of Iran’s exports and imports are conducted through sea, 6 percent through transit, two percent via railroad and a little percent through airway.

The move came after Russian officials said Tehran and Moscow have agreed to increase the value of their annual bilateral trade to $10 billion.
